The Command and Data Subsystem (CDS) on Cassini is responsible for uplink command processing, spacecraft intercommunications and control, and downlink telemetry formatting. The 10.7 year mission life, 160 minute round-trip light time, and extended periods of operation without continuous ground communications drive the CDS design in directions of redundancy, autonomy, and fault protection to accomodate the mission objectives.
